After reading http://www.howtoforge.com/how-to-add-ppp-kernel-support-to-openvz-containers
Before we can use PPP in the container, we must enable the PPP kernel modules on the host system:
modprobe tun
modprobe ppp-compress-18
modprobe ppp_mppe
modprobe ppp_deflate
modprobe ppp_async
modprobe pppoatm
modprobe ppp_generic
